Anger makes a dull man witty,
But keeps him poor in eternity,
A man shrinks when he is angry,
And grows in tranquil serenity.

When anger flow in the body,
You lose your temper – your folly,
When distempered – a tragedy,
You lose reason – a calamity.

Anger at lies last in infinity,
Anger at truth is momentary,
Speech – when you are angry,
Will but make you feel sorry.

It is not worth being angry,
And any threat is a folly,
Reason is your tool mighty,
Think of consequences finally.
 
Anger causes resentment only,
A headache and tension clearly,
Forgiveness propels growth surely,
With laughter and lightness totally.

© Munindra Misra
